Murder Most Confederate: Tales of Crimes Quite Uncivil, edited by Martin H.

Greenberg, is an anthology of short stories set in the Civil War in which the murders take place in the Confederacy.

Authors such as Ed Gorman, Gary A. Braunbeck, and Edward D. Hoch contributed stories.
